| Monday, August 27, 1894 |
| Dear sister Hilda & little Neil went down to St. Cloud. How I |
| will miss them. Don't know if I will stay long since they have |
| gone. |
| Monday, September 10, 1894 |
| I went over to Rice Lake to look after the hay over there. The |
| fire came and I fought it all day alone and without anything to |
| eat. Saved nine stacks out of ten but it was the hardest day I |
| ever put in fighting fire a day I shall always remember. |
| Monday, September 03, 1894 |
| The towns of Poekgoma, Hinckley and Sandstone were |
| totally destroyed by forest fires over 500 people were burned |
| to death. It was the worst holocaust that has ever happened |
| in the history of the county. |
| Wednesday, September 26, 1894 |
| I went over on the big island and went all over it. Had not |
| been over it for six years. Took my last boat ride I guess for |
| some time anyway on Farm Island Lake. |
| Friday, September 28, 1894 | 20 years afterward - |
| I started home once more. Got there the 29. they were all | 1914 - and sometimes |
| glad to see me. Sunday the 30 I went up to see Manda. We | don't yet |
| went to church and then I stayed until 12 o'clock. She |
| seemed glad to see me but would not say much. I don't know |
| what to make of her. |
